Cue The Economic Recovery

markets, or what's left of them, are starting to sniff out the economic recovery. We see this in one of the very few market signals we still have a modicum of onfidence in -- the Russell 2000 small-cap index relative performance to the S&P500, which bottomed in late March and, though volatile over the? Read Full Article »

Show comments Hide Comments

Related Articles

Market Overview
Search Stock Quotes